You can try spin casting off Beachy Head, 20 min. drive from Victoria to East Sooke Park, pack a lunch, leave your car in the parks parking lot and there is a nice trail hike, 20-30 min. hike in. Just follow the trail signs. Once you get to the top of the rock bluff you have to hike down/traverse the face down to the water line to get to the point. Wear good hiking shoes, bring a good spin casting rod and reel, even a spare reel or spool or line for back up, bring buzz bombs and lures. I used to catch black bass and rock cod from the shore there using leaded white fly jigs working the shore bottom..just don't wait till it hits the bottom or you will get snagged up... Just watch for big swells, If your standing on the outer rock area of the point just watch for big swells, they can engolf the entire point, very powerfull and take you in.. just be carefull some thing to watch for.
